Located just south of Owatonna near the Geneva–Hartland exit (exit 22) along Interstate 35 in Southern MN, this exceptional 100.93 +/- deeded acre property offers a rare opportunity to own highly productive and well-positioned cropland in a strong agricultural region. With 97.67 +/- tillable acres and an impressive CPI of 88.6, this farm is well-suited for consistent, high-yield production. The land features a natural slope and favorable topography that promotes effective drainage, further enhancing its long-term productivity. A proven history of strong crop performance underscores the quality of this tract. The property also includes 3.92 +/- acres enrolled in CRP, generating $745 annually through September 30, 2030. Notably, all acres are income-producing, whether through crop rent or CRP payments—making this an attractive investment for both operators and investors. Recent improvements include new waterway construction, contributing to soil conservation and long-term land stewardship. Strategically positioned with excellent visibility and direct proximity to Interstate 35, the farm benefits from outstanding access via a major overpass, offering both logistical convenience and long-term investment appeal.
